8+ What is the Bible's Last Word? Amen!

what is the last word of the bible

8+ What is the Bible's Last Word? Amen!

The final word in the Book of Revelation, the concluding book of the Christian Bible, is “Amen.” This term, derived from Hebrew, expresses affirmation, agreement, or a solemn declaration of truth. It signifies the definitive and conclusive nature of the preceding text.

This concluding word carries significant weight, serving as a powerful affirmation of the prophecies and pronouncements contained within the Book of Revelation. Its placement underscores the finality of the described events and the unwavering certainty of the divine message. Historically, the use of “Amen” has held liturgical significance in both Jewish and Christian traditions, serving as a communal affirmation of shared beliefs and doctrines.

8+ Latin Words for Power & Might

what is the word for power in latin

8+ Latin Words for Power & Might

Several Latin terms convey the concept of power, each with specific nuances. Potestas refers to official power, authority, or legal capacity. Imperium denotes military command, supreme power, or dominion. Vis signifies physical force, strength, or violent power. Auctoritas represents influence, prestige, and moral authority. For example, a Roman consul held potestas and imperium, while a renowned philosopher might wield auctoritas. The choice of word depends on the specific type of power being described.

Understanding these nuances is crucial for accurately interpreting Latin texts, particularly historical and legal documents. The different shades of meaning illuminate the complexities of Roman social and political structures. Recognizing the distinctions between formal authority, military command, physical force, and moral influence provides a deeper understanding of Roman concepts of leadership and control. This knowledge is essential for anyone studying Roman history, law, philosophy, or literature.

7+ Taps Song Lyrics & History: Full Version

what are the words to taps song

7+ Taps Song Lyrics & History: Full Version

The melody known as “Taps” is generally played without lyrics. The tune itself evokes a sense of solemnity and finality, serving as a musical expression of respect and remembrance. While some unofficial lyrics exist, they are not commonly used during official military ceremonies. The most well-known unofficial lyrics, “Day is done, gone the sun,” capture the mournful nature of the piece. However, the power of the bugle call lies primarily in its simple, haunting melody.

This bugle call holds deep historical significance, originating during the American Civil War. It quickly became a standard military funeral ceremony element and has since been adopted by armed forces worldwide. Its enduring presence underscores its effectiveness in conveying emotions of loss, honor, and reflection. The universality of its message transcends language, making it a powerful symbol of reverence and closure.
